1. Environmental Testing (Qualification & Acceptance)

Thermal
Thermal Vacuum (TVAC) test

Simulates orbital vacuum + hot/soak/cold cycles

Thermal balance test

Validates thermal math model vs real hardware

ISRO TBTV Standard

ISRO calls this the TBTV (Thermal Balance Thermal Vacuum) test, usually run in the Space Simulation Chamber at ISAC/URSC or IISU

Mechanical / Dynamic
Vibration testing (sine + random vibration)

Simulates launch vehicle loads

Acoustic testing

In a reverberation chamber, simulates acoustic pressure during liftoff/max-Q

Shock testing

Pyro shock simulation (separation events, deployment mechanisms)

Sine burst test

Static load simulation of max-g during ascent

Mass Properties
CG (Center of Gravity) determination

Precise determination of satellite mass balance

MOI (Moment of Inertia) measurement

Rotational inertia measurement

Spin balancing

For spin-stabilized satellites
